2. What Are Active Ingredients in Skincare? (Professional Definition)
2.1 Technical Definition from a Formulation Perspective
In cosmetic science, ingredients are typically divided into three functional categories:
| Ingredient Category | Primary Role |
|---|---|
| Base Ingredients | Solvents, emollients, emulsifiers |
| Functional Additives | Preservatives, thickeners, chelators |
| Active Ingredients | Deliver measurable biological or cosmetic effects |
Active ingredients are substances that, when applied at an effective concentration, interact directly with the skin’s biological or physiological processes to deliver a specific, validated benefit.
These benefits may include:
- Improving skin barrier function
- Reducing hyperpigmentation
- Stimulating collagen synthesis
- Modulating inflammation
- Enhancing hydration at a cellular level

2.2 Active Ingredients vs. Marketing Ingredients
One of the most common misconceptions we encounter—especially among new brands—is the assumption that:
“If an ingredient sounds advanced or expensive, it must be an active ingredient.”
This is not always true.
From a manufacturer’s standpoint:
- Activity is defined by function and dose, not by cost
- Many highly effective actives (e.g., niacinamide, panthenol) are affordable and well-studied
- Conversely, some exotic extracts contribute more to storytelling than measurable efficacy
3. How Active Ingredients Work in the Skin

Understanding how active ingredients work is essential for effective product development.
3.1 The Skin Barrier Challenge
Human skin is designed to protect the body, not absorb substances easily. The stratum corneum acts as a highly selective barrier.
For an active ingredient to work, it must:
- Have an appropriate molecular size
- Exhibit a suitable lipophilic/hydrophilic balance
- Remain stable until it reaches its target site
This is why modern activities are often delivered using:
- Encapsulation technologies
- Liposomes or nano-emulsions
- Stabilized derivatives
3.2 Concentration Matters More Than Presence
From a regulatory and performance standpoint, dose defines activity.
For example:
| Active Ingredient | Typical Effective Range |
|---|---|
| Niacinamide | 2–5% |
| Retinol | 0.1–0.5% |
| Salicylic Acid | 0.5–2% |
| Hyaluronic Acid | 0.1–1% |
Including an active ingredient below its effective threshold may satisfy label claims but will not deliver real performance, a critical concern for Western consumers.

5. Main Categories of Active Ingredients Used in Western Skincare

5.1 Anti-Aging Active Ingredients
Anti-aging remains the largest active ingredient segment in Western skincare.
Common examples include:
- Retinol and retinoids
- Peptides
- Vitamin C and derivatives
- Coenzyme Q10
Western brands place strong emphasis on:
- Stability under light and oxygen
- Controlled release systems
- Irritation mitigation strategies

5.2 Brightening and Tone-Correcting Actives
In Western markets, “brightening” focuses on even skin tone, not skin whitening.
Popular activities include:
- Niacinamide
- Tranexamic Acid
- Alpha-Arbutin
- Vitamin C derivatives
Niacinamide, in particular, is considered a multi-functional gold standard, valued for barrier repair, oil regulation, and tone improvement. Its profile is well documented on INCI Decoder’s niacinamide page.
5.3 Hydration and Barrier Repair Actives


Barrier-focused skincare is one of the fastest-growing trends in EU and US markets.
Key activities include:
- Ceramides
- Hyaluronic Acid (various molecular weights)
- Cholesterol
- Squalane
Western formulators increasingly favor biomimetic lipid systems that replicate natural skin structure.
6. Regulatory Considerations for Active Ingredients (EU & US)
6.1 European Union (EU)
EU compliance is governed by Regulation (EC) No. 1223/2009, which covers:
- Ingredient restrictions
- Safety assessments
- CPNP notification
Full regulatory guidance is available on the European Commission’s cosmetics regulation page.
6.2 United States (US)
In the US, the primary concern is avoiding drug classification through claims or ingredient misuse. Some actives—especially sunscreens—are regulated as OTC drugs rather than cosmetics.

8. Frequently Asked Questions (FAQ)
Q1: Are more active ingredients always better?
No. Western markets favor simplicity, synergy, and safety over complexity.
Q2: Are natural ingredients automatically active?
No. Only ingredients with validated biological effects qualify as actives.
Q3: Do active ingredients require clinical testing?
While not always mandatory, clinical or in vitro data strongly improve credibility.
Q4: Can one active ingredient deliver multiple benefits?
Yes. Niacinamide is a prime example.
Q5: Why is stability so critical?
An unstable active may degrade before the product reaches the consumer.
Q6: How early should regulation be considered?
From the ingredient selection stage, not after formulation is complete.
